Transaction 290b060c381a0b57f6912562db628e7cdc461faabddb009c98e33e6ce79ac597
1 Input
1 Output
-
290b060c381a0b57f6912562db628e7cdc461faabddb009c98e33e6ce79ac597:0
- value
- 3318643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28396a3d926f003eb54dc155fcd6c76ba026cbd6 OP_EQUAL
- address
- 35MhjUsAjN69EtPwYJAALpkTeUtCjTrAC8